Is Budapest Bigger Than Houston?

Yes — Houston is 3.3x larger than Budapest by area. Houston spans 1,725 km² (666 mi²) while Budapest covers 525 km² (203 mi²) — a difference of 1,200 km². You could fit Budapest inside Houston approximately 3 times.

To put Budapest's size in perspective, its area of 525 km² is about 1.2x smaller than Seoul. Meanwhile, Houston at 1,725 km² is roughly the same size as London.

In more relatable units, Budapest's 525 km² is about 74,000 American football fields, 150 times the area of Central Park, or 9 times the area of Manhattan. Houston, by comparison, equals about 242,000 American football fields, 29 times the area of Manhattan, or 16 times the area of Paris.

About Budapest

Budapest is the capital and most populous city of Hungary. It is Hungary's primate city with 1.7 million inhabitants and its greater metro area has a population of about 3.3 million, representing one-third of the country's population and producing above 40% of the country's economic output. Budapest is the political, economic, and cultural center of the country, among the ten largest cities in the European Union and the second largest urban area in Central and Eastern Europe.

About Houston

Houston is the most populous city in the U.S. state of Texas and the Southern United States. It is the fourth-most populous city in the United States, with a population of 2.3 million at the 2020 census. The Greater Houston metropolitan area, at 7.8 million residents, is the fifth-most populous metropolitan area in the nation and second-most populous in Texas. Located in Southeast Texas near Galveston Bay and the Gulf of Mexico, Houston is the county seat of Harris County.

Population Density

Budapest has a population density of 3,219 people per km² — a moderately dense city. Houston, with 1,333 people per km², is a relatively spread-out city. Budapest is noticeably denser, packing 2.4 times more people per square kilometer.
